Sizzling Homemade Potato Steak Broccoli Foil Pack

Ingredients

Scale

For the Foil Pack:

  • 1 lb steak (ribeye, sirloin, or flank steak, cut into bite-sized pieces)
  • 1 lb baby potatoes (halved or quartered if large)
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• 2 tbsp unsalted butter (melted)
  • 3 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 tsp steak seasoning (or a mix of salt, black pepper, and garlic powder)
  • ½ tsp crushed red pepper flakes (optional, for heat)
  • Fresh parsley (for garnish)
  • Grated Parmesan cheese (optional, for extra flavor)

Instructions

Step 1: Prep the Ingredients

  • Cut the steak into bite-sized pieces and season with olive oil, garlic, smoked paprika, steak seasoning, and red pepper flakes.
  • Halve or quarter the baby potatoes for even cooking.
  • Toss the broccoli florets with a bit of olive oil for extra crispiness.

Step 2: Assemble the Foil Packs

  • Tear off large pieces of aluminum foil (about 12×12 inches).
  • Divide the potatoes, steak, and broccoli evenly between the foil sheets.
  • Drizzle melted butter over each portion and fold the foil into a sealed packet.

Step 3: Cook the Foil Packs

On the Grill:

  • Preheat the grill to medium-high heat (400°F).
  • Place foil packs on the grill and cook for 15-20 minutes, flipping halfway through.

In the Oven:

  •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  • Bake the foil packs on a baking sheet for 20-25 minutes.

Over a Campfire:

  • Place foil packs over hot coals and cook for 15-20 minutes, flipping occasionally.

Step 4: Serve and Enjoy!

  • Carefully open the foil packs (watch out for steam!).
  • Garnish with fresh parsley and grated Parmesan for extra flavor.
  • Dig in and enjoy the deliciousness!

Notes

  • Adjust the Cooking Time Based on Steak Doneness – If you prefer your steak more on the rare side, cook the potatoes for 10 minutes first, then add the steak and broccoli to the foil pack and finish cooking for another 8-10 minutes.
  • Don’t Skip the Butter! – The melted butter enhances the flavor and helps keep the steak juicy. You can substitute it with ghee or a dairy-free alternative if needed.
  • For Extra Smoky Flavor – If cooking on a grill or campfire, use a little liquid smoke or a sprinkle of smoked paprika to enhance the taste.
